4-month subway shutdown to Rockaways begins this week to restore lingering Sandy impacts
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

A serious winter subway enchancment mission is about to start this week, with the MTA shuttering service on the Rockaway Line for 4 months to deal with lingering harm left behind by Superstorm Sandy and strengthen infrastructure in anticipation of future storms.

The winter service interruption kicks off Friday, Jan. 17, and lasts by way of Might. The MTA says A prepare service will not be working throughout that point between Howard Seaside-JFK Airport and Far Rockaway-Mott Avenue or Rockaway Park-Seaside 116 Road.

The Rockaway Park Shuttle may even be impacted. Riders will not have shuttle service to or from Broad Channel, and the shuttle trains will not run in any respect in the course of the first weekend (Jan. 17-20). Learn up on full service impacts right here.

“It’s time to make the A prepare extra dependable and resilient for Rockaway riders, and this plan is the quickest and best approach to do it,” MTA Chair and CEO Janno Lieber stated in an announcement.

“I’m confident the NYC Transit team will deliver on fast and frequent alternative service while work is underway — just as they did for ​ train customers over the summer,” Lieber stated, referencing the G prepare summer season shutdown.

Rehabilitation work on the Rockaway Line is crucial, the MTA says, to restore longstanding harm following Sandy. Regardless of the emergency repairs within the months instantly following the catastrophe, the company says there are nonetheless important repairs wanted to guard transit operations throughout future storms.

“The viaducts and bridge that carry trains across Broad Channel need major upgrades to help protect the line from future storms and ensure reliable service for over 9,000 daily riders,” the MTA stated in a press launch.

So how can these impacted riders get round in the course of the four-month shutdown?

The MTA says free shuttle buses will assist commuters get round. The Q97 will run service between Howard Seaside and Far Rockaway, whereas the Q109 will run from Howard Seaside to Seaside 67 Road.

The Lengthy Island Rail Street may even be accessible to Rockaway residents at a reduction. The fare will probably be diminished to $2.75 every approach for individuals shopping for tickets on the LIRR Far Rockaway Station.
